Kohli Hails "Young India" After Series Win Over England
New Delhi, Feb 26 : Former Indian captain Virat Kohli took to social media to praise the Indian cricket team after their thrilling victory in the fourth Test against England, securing an unassailable 3-1 lead in the five-match series.
Kohli commended the team's fighting spirit, tweeting, "Phenomenal series win by our young team. The team showed grit, determination and resilience."
The victory came courtesy of a well-rounded performance by the Indian team. Openers Rohit Sharma (55) and Shubman Gill (52*) provided a solid start, while young talent Dhruv Jurel shone with a match-winning 90 in the first innings and a crucial 39 not out in the second, earning him the Player of the Match award.
BCCI Secretary Jay Shah also lauded the team's efforts, highlighting the contributions of bowlers Ravichandran Ashwin, Ravindra Jadeja, and Kuldeep Yadav, alongside Rohit Sharma's leadership and the consistent batting performances of Yashasvi Jaiswal and Shubman Gill.
